Why Government Projects Demand Bespoke Solar Lighting Solutions
Government projects, whether they involve illuminating a new public park, a sprawling highway, a remote village road, or a security-sensitive facility, present a unique set of challenges and requirements. Unlike standard commercial installations, these projects often have strict adherence to local regulations, specific aesthetic demands, extreme environmental exposures, and non-negotiable performance criteria. This is where custom-made solar street lights become indispensable. A one-size-fits-all approach simply cannot address variables such as:
- Specific Lighting Needs: Different areas require different lumen outputs, light distribution patterns (e.g., Type II for roads, Type V for large areas), and color temperatures to ensure optimal visibility and safety without light pollution.
- Geographic and Climatic Conditions: Solar irradiance levels vary significantly by location, as do temperature extremes, humidity, wind loads, and prevalence of dust or snow. A custom system accounts for these variables to ensure consistent performance and durability.
- Aesthetic Integration: Public spaces often require lighting solutions that blend seamlessly with existing architecture or landscape design, demanding specific pole heights, finishes, and luminaire styles.
- Energy Autonomy Requirements: Government projects often require specific days of autonomy (e.g., 3-5 days without sun) to guarantee uninterrupted illumination, which necessitates precise sizing of solar panels and batteries.
- Budgetary Constraints and Long-Term Value: While initial costs are considered, governments prioritize long-term operational savings and minimal maintenance. Custom solutions are designed for maximum efficiency and longevity, providing a superior return on investment over decades.
Key Considerations for Custom-Made Solar Street Lights for Government Projects
Designing and implementing custom-made solar street lights for government projects requires meticulous attention to several critical components to ensure optimal performance, durability, and cost-efficiency. A reputable solar street light manufacturer and supplier will possess expertise in each of these areas:
- High-Efficiency Solar Panels: The heart of any solar lighting system. Monocrystalline silicon panels typically offer higher efficiency rates, often ranging from 20-23%, making them ideal for areas with limited space or lower solar irradiance. Sizing must be precise to meet energy demands, considering peak sun hours and desired autonomy.
- Advanced Battery Technology: Lithium Iron Phosphate (LiFePO4) batteries are the industry standard for solar street lighting due to their superior cycle life (often 2,000-6,000 cycles, translating to 5-10+ years), safety, and stable performance across various temperatures. Battery capacity must be calculated to provide power for multiple days without sunlight, a crucial aspect for governmental reliability.
- High-Performance LED Luminaires: The light source itself. LEDs offer exceptional energy efficiency and longevity (L70 ratings often exceed 50,000-100,000 hours). Key specifications include lumen output, efficacy (lumens per watt), Color Rendering Index (CRI), and correlated color temperature (CCT). Optic designs are vital for precise light distribution, minimizing glare and maximizing coverage.
- Intelligent Charge Controllers and Control Systems: MPPT (Maximum Power Point Tracking) charge controllers optimize power harvesting from solar panels, enhancing overall system efficiency. Advanced control systems can incorporate dimming schedules, motion sensors, and even remote monitoring capabilities via IoT platforms, allowing for proactive maintenance and energy management.
- Robust Pole Design and Materials: The structural integrity of the pole is paramount. Materials like hot-dip galvanized steel or aluminum offer excellent corrosion resistance. The design must account for local wind loads, seismic activity, and required aesthetic finishes, ensuring long-term stability and safety.
- Environmental Resilience: Beyond just wind and temperature, the entire system must be designed to withstand dust, humidity, salt spray (for coastal areas), and potential vandalism. IP (Ingress Protection) ratings for luminaires and battery enclosures are critical.

Q5: What is the typical lifespan of custom solar street light components?A: The major components have varying lifespans. High-quality LED luminaires can last 50,000 to 100,000 hours (L70 rating), typically 10-20 years. LiFePO4 batteries generally last 5-10 years or more, depending on charge/discharge cycles and climate. Solar panels can maintain high efficiency for 25 years or more. The robust poles are designed to last for decades.
